- Keep your guests informed, make sure they know the who, what, where, when and how (and what to wear) so they show up on time and ready!
- Don't make them wait....if your ceremony or dinner is set to start at a specific time then do what you must to start on time. Never make your guests wait too long for food and drink, keep them satisfied and happy!
- Give them a variety of things to do and see. If you love dancing and think ALL your guests will love dancing as much as you do, well, your wrong. Provide a quieter area or activity for those who need to take a break from the music.
- Meet and greet each person. If you are hosting a big party this seems daunting, but it's a must! You invited them, so make sure you thank them in person for coming.
